Key Responsibilities:
• Maintain the vessel's general cleanliness and perform routine maintenance tasks
• Participate in lookout duties and assist with navigation
• Drive tenders, Zodiacs, Rescue boats, and lifeboats as required
• Participate in drills and additional shipboard/shoreside training
• Attend crew meetings and assist with passenger exchanges and vessel turnarounds
• Undertake other reasonable duties assigned by shipboard management

Certifications and Qualifications:
Navigational Watch Rating, Remote First Aid & Advanced CPR, Certificate of Sea Safety STCW95/CoST, AMSA Medical Certification, Certificate of Proficiency in Survival Craft, Crowd Control & Crisis Management, MSIC card, ASSB, Steering Certificate (issued on board)
Accommodation and Food:
Food and accommodation are provided free of charge while aboard the vessels. Crew quarters are shared, with periodic inspections by the Master and Purser.
Shared Mess room and Laundry facilities are available onboard.
